Introduction

Business ethics monitors ethical conduct of members of the company and other partners. Through the business ethics two important goals of the company can be achieved: the Charter and the rules of its members and partners, and control over them. In the real sense, business ethics is a set of rules and laws of business, based on common values. The concept of value means those whom society and every individual has their preference. Social values ??include qualities such as conscience, correctness, respect, justice, etc. In terms of business, it matches the quality of products, customer satisfaction, and compliance with the rules in the advertising of the product, health and safety (Weiss, 2009).

Business ethics is based on respect for the interests of not only its own company, but also its partners, customers, and society in general. This rule also applies to the competition that does not prejudice the techniques that go beyond the competition. Ethics advocates acceptance of benefits and the maximum number of market participants and equal access to them (Darnell L.,n.d.). The basis of business ethics are the moral standards that are based on language, culture and traditions of the country and people. The business and social ethics is the foundation, which is a set of ethical standards and concepts. Ethical Analysis of the Movie John Q

The Ethical and Legal Issues Depicted In the Movie, John Q

In the Movie John Q, there were three ethical dilemmas that the character of the John Q faces in the movie which are the human dignity principles, dilemma of self sacrifice and the ethics of health care. These issues of ethical phenomenon were faces by the three characters Rebecca Payne, Dr. Klein and the main leading role of the movies John Q. The John Q. in the movies was the one who faces all the three issues which have been highlighted above. Throughout the whole movie, John Q has faces the ethical issue of human dignity.
